Pros & Cons
✓ PROS
Fine-tuned models for game assets, product mockups, concept art
Image-to-image and inpainting powerful for iterations
Real-Time Canvas for live AI editing
Motion feature generates short animations from images
API available for production pipelines
✗ CONS
Learning curve steeper than DALL-E 3
Token system confusing to new users
Photorealism inconsistent vs Midjourney

Real Output Sample
Actual output from our test session — same prompt across all tools so you can compare.
LEONARDO AI · REAL OUTPUTTest: 'Fantasy RPG character — female elf archer, forest armor, emerald gems, concept art style'
Leonardo (Fantasy model): 9.1/10 — Accurate armor detail, correct color palette
Midjourney v6: 8.8/10 — Slightly better lighting
DALL-E 3: 7.2/10 — Less detailed, less 'game-ready'
Best use: Character sheets, item concept art, UI elements
